What Is the Jubilee Fund?
West Valley Community Church receives numerous requests for financial assistance - on average two or three each week. Even if it were possible, it simply isn't wise for any church to give money to everyone that requests it. However, there are times when members of our own congregation face hardship and we need to respond. The Jubilee Fund was established so that when a church family is hit by financial crisis, we can help. Typically, a member of the Jubilee Fund committee becomes aware of the need and discusses it with the other two members. The members then determine how to respond.
This committee tries to reflect the concern and compassion of the entire congregation. However, out of respect for each other's privacy, none of the details regarding the individual needs are shared with the church body. Only the three committee members and the treasurer know who has received funds and the amounts. This fund, as part of all WVCC finances, is subject to an annual independent audit. Currently the Jubilee Committee consists of Board Chairman Sandy Tonseth, Pastor Keith Wheaton and Pastor Brandon Tonseth. Support for the Jubilee Fund comes from designated gifts and occasional special collections. As we approach year's end, these resources are almost depleted. From Our Pastor Emeritus, Clio Thomas
Pastor Clio Thomas serves as "Area Director" for the Asia/Pacific mission field of the Advent Christian Denomination. One of his duties is to encourage mission workers in a variety of settings throughout Asia. The following is a weekly installment of his letter, sent literally around the world to those in his charge.Jesus Never DisappointsPaul tells us in Romans 10, "No one who believes in Him (Christ) will ever be disappointed." That is a bold claim that Paul throws out to us. It does not mean that life will never disappoint us, or that other people will not disappoint us, but that Jesus will never disappoint us! One of the great preachers of the Christian Church in England was a man by the name of Arthur John Gossip. He preached a sermon with the title "A Peep At The Last Page". In that sermon he says, "Have you ever been reading an exciting tale in which the hero seemed so hopelessly entangled that escape seemed impossible, and you yielded to the itching curiosity that could not wait, and you took a peep at the last page to find out how it all ends?"
